Ohio sits in EPA Radon Zone 1 — the highest-risk classification in the country — and Wood County properties regularly test above the EPA action level of 4.0 pCi/L. Bloomdale's clay-heavy soils and the limestone bedrock running beneath the village create exactly the kind of geology that traps and channels radon gas into basements, crawlspaces, and slab-on-grade homes along Main Street, Cherry Street, and the newer builds out toward SR 18.

Radon is invisible, odorless, and the second-leading cause of lung cancer in the United States according to the U.S. Surgeon General. You won't smell it. Your HVAC system won't catch it. The only way to know your number is a measured test from a licensed Ohio radon professional. Long-Term Homeowner Radon Testing

For Bloomdale homeowners who aren't selling but want a true seasonal-average reading, we install long-term alpha-track or electret detectors for 90 days to 12 months. This catches the winter spikes Wood County homes are famous for, when frozen ground and sealed windows push indoor radon levels well above summer baselines.

Our Bloomdale Radon Testing Process — Step by Step

Transparency starts with knowing exactly what happens after you call. Here's our five-step protocol for every Bloomdale radon test:

  1. Intake Call (5 minutes): We confirm property address, square footage, foundation type (basement, crawl, slab), and your deadline. You get a flat-rate quote on the call.
  2. Scheduling & Closed-House Setup: We schedule deployment within 24–72 hours. You receive written closed-house instructions — windows shut, HVAC normal operation, no exterior doors propped open — so the test reflects real living conditions.
  3. Device Deployment: A licensed technician (RC202) places a calibrated CRM in the lowest livable level, photographs placement, and starts the test. Minimum 48-hour test duration per EPA Protocol for Radon Measurements.
  4. Retrieval & Lab-Grade Reporting: We retrieve the device, download hourly readings, and produce a signed PDF report with average pCi/L, hourly trend chart, tamper detection, and a clear recommendation.
  5. Next-Step Consultation: If your number is below 4.0 pCi/L, you're done. If it's elevated, we walk you through mitigation options — including a fixed-price quote that same day so you can act before closing.

Local Expertise: Why Bloomdale Geology Matters for Radon

Bloomdale sits at the intersection of two radon risk factors: the carbonate bedrock of the Maumee Lowlands and the dense glacial till soils common across Wood, Hancock, and Henry counties. Uranium-bearing minerals in those layers decay into radium and then radon gas, which migrates upward through soil cracks and into Ohio basements through sump pits, slab penetrations, and crawlspace floors.

We've tested and mitigated properties throughout the area — older farmhouses out near Eagleville Road, post-war homes along Main Street, newer subdivisions edging toward Cygnet and North Baltimore, and commercial buildings near the SR 18 / Mitchell Road corridor. Average indoor radon levels in this part of Wood County frequently fall between 4.0 and 8.0 pCi/L, with basement readings occasionally exceeding 20 pCi/L. The EPA action level is 4.0; the World Health Organization recommends action above 2.7.

How do I choose a radon testing near me provider in Bloomdale?

Ask for the license number in writing. Confirm the test method (CRM is the gold standard for real estate). Verify turnaround time before you book. Ask whether the same company can mitigate if your number comes back high — switching providers mid-transaction wastes days you may not have.

What should I look for in radon testing near me services?

EPA-aligned protocol, closed-house condition documentation, calibrated equipment with current calibration certificates, tamper detection on the device, hourly trend reporting, and a licensed Ohio professional performing the placement. Anything less and the test may not hold up to lender or buyer scrutiny.

How long does radon testing near me take?

The test itself runs a minimum of 48 hours under closed-house conditions per EPA protocol. From your phone call to a signed report in hand, most Bloomdale transactions complete in 3–5 days. Same-day deployment is available for closings under 7 days out.
